ABSTRACT:
Embodiments of the present invention provide a secure programming paradigm, and a protected cache that enable a processor to handle secret/private information while preventing, at the hardware level, malicious applications from accessing this information by circumventing the other protection mechanisms. A protected cache may be used as a building block to enhance the security of applications trying to create, manage and protect secure data. Other embodiments are described and claimed.
